WFLI, the 50,000 watt AM signal announces its new news/talk lineup led by the addition of Good Morning Chattanooga from NewsChannel 9, WTVC. On weekday mornings WFLI will simulcast Good Morning Chattanooga starting at 4:30 a.m.
The move allows morning viewers to stay with the NewsChannel 9 team as they make their way into work.
WFLI President and Co-Owner Evan Stone feels the addition of Good Morning Chattanooga helps set the station apart. “There are a lot of options in the market now, certainly more than when WFLI signed on the air in 1961, Good Morning Chattanooga offers us the opportunity to be the only radio station in the area that’s live with local news and information beginning at 4:30 each morning. Much like WFLI, NewsChannel 9 has a long and successful history in Chattanooga. We love the idea of merging the two together.”
WTVC Vice President and General Manager Todd Ricke agrees. “It’s a win, win not just for our stations and news products but also for advertisers when we can work towards broadcast opportunities that span different media.”
